First, your hips are pretty high on the start and your back is rounded. Lower the hip and keep on your heels. Besides that, that clean looked ok.

You have your weight on your toes when you're jerking, that's why you can't jerk the weight. It forces you to come forward and you lose the jerk. Heels, heel and heels will solve the problem.
